*NVIDIA *has been playing a major role in High Performance Computing
architectural solutions involving automation in multiple fields like deep
learning, self-driving cars, gaming, pro-graphics, autonomous machines,
research, Artificial Intelligence and much more.

During our monthly technical session during August 6th, Dr. Lars S. Nyland
senior Architect, Computer Architecture group, NVIDIA will walkthrough the
highlights of NVIDIA GPU internal architectures that makes NVIDIA an
optimal choice in the area of High Performance Computing.

*Speaker Information:*

*Dr. Lars S. Nyland works as a Senior Architect in Compute Architecture
Group, NVIDIA.  Dr. Nyland joined NVIDIA 13 years ago just as NVIDIA had
decided to promote general-purpose computing on GPUs.  He has contributed
to the designs with new features for parallel computing, verification of
novel mathematical functions, and performance evaluation.  He has been a
resident of the Triangle area of NC for 37 years, coming to Durham to get
his PhD at Duke followed by 12 years of being a professor at UNC-CH.*
